比特币密钥是什么?比特币密钥的作用与用途解析?

欧易OKX
欧易OKX
简介: 欧易OKX是全球知名的数字货币交易平台,提供安全、多样化的交易服务和创新金融产品,满足不同用户需求。

比特币密钥是连接用户与比特币网络的重要桥梁,它确保了每一笔交易的安全性与有效性,是控制比特币资金的核心要素。通过私钥、公钥与地址三个层级的配合,用户不仅可以拥有和转移自己的比特币资产,同时也能够保障交易的匿名性与透明性。无论是新手还是资深用户,了解比特币密钥的工作原理与管理方式都至关重要。在本文中,我们将带您深入探索比特币密钥的定义、技术原理、核心作用、应用场景及安全实践,为您全面提升对比特币资产的管理能力。

1

比特币密钥的核心定义

私钥

私钥是比特币所有权的根本证明,它是一段随机生成的256位二进制数(即32字节),通常以64位十六进制字符串或52位Base58编码的WIF格式呈现。私钥的安全性与随机性息息相关,它通过椭圆曲线数字签名算法(ECDSA)生成相对应的公钥,而从公钥无法逆推回私钥,确保了密钥的安全性和隐私性。

公钥

公钥是通过私钥经过椭圆曲线乘法运算生成的,原始格式为64字节(未压缩)。当采用压缩格式时,它仅需要33字节,由一个标识符(0x02或0x03)和32字节的x坐标组成。公钥的主要作用是作为“数字身份”,用于验证私钥签名的交易是否合法,却不具备资金的控制权。

地址

比特币地址是公钥经过双重哈希处理的结果,目的是用于接收比特币。生成地址的过程相当复杂,首先对64字节的公钥进行SHA-256哈希处理,然后将结果进行RIPEMD-160哈希,最后添加版本号和校验码,通过Base58编码生成最终的比特币地址。这一过程确保了比特币地址的唯一性与安全性。

比特币密钥的技术原理

非对称加密机制

比特币密钥体系依赖于非对称加密机制,确保了安全的资产转移。私钥用于对交易进行数字签名,而公钥则用于验证这些签名的有效性。底层技术使用的椭圆曲线方程为“y² = x³ + 7”(即secp256k1曲线),此曲线不仅能够高效计算,还具备抵抗量子攻击的特性。

密钥层级结构

为了解决多地址管理的问题,比特币使用了BIP-32标准,该标准允许从主密钥派生出多个子密钥。以HMAC-SHA512为基础的强化派生公式为ki=HMAC-SHA512(Key=链码,Data=父私钥||索引)。这样的设计大幅简化了密钥管理,用户只需备份主密钥即可管理所有子地址,这也成为现代硬件钱包与HD钱包的核心技术。

比特币密钥的核心作用

资金控制

私钥持有者具备其对应地址内资金的绝对控制权,任何交易都必须经过私钥签名才能生效。例如,在比特币的脚本系统中,标准P2PKH交易所需的验证脚本确保了私钥持有者的合法性,为比特币的转移提供了强有力的保障。

数字签名验证

数字签名为比特币交易提供了防篡改的关键保障。ECDSA算法在签名时产生两个参数r和s,验证过程则需要计算相关公式,以此确保交易确实是由私钥持有者发起且未被篡改。这一机制有效地保护了交易的不可否认性和完整性。

多重签名校验

比特币密钥系统支持n-of-m门限签名,能够实现多方共同控制资金的需求。这一功能广泛应用于企业和共管账户的场景,通过设置多个签名者的要求降低了单点私钥丢失或被盗的风险,提高了资金管理的灵活性与安全性。

比特币密钥的应用场景

钱包管理

当前现代比特币钱包普遍采用HD(分层确定性)架构,其标准派生路径可通过主密钥生成各种接收及找零地址。用户无需逐一备份所有私钥,这大大提高了管理的便捷性。同时,静默支付协议的引入,为用户提供了更好的隐私保护,避免了交易关联的暴露。

交易构建

在UTXO模型中,每一笔交易输入都需要签署对应的私钥。随着SegWit升级,签名数据得以分离,交易体积得以缩小,签名验证效率也获得提升。这种机制确保了对未花费交易输出(UTXO)所有权的证明,只有拥有正确签名的交易才能转移至新地址。

智能合约交互

比特币脚本系统通过操作码支持基于密钥的智能合约,包括Taproot升级引入的Schnorr签名聚合技术。该技术允许将多个签名合并为一个,不仅节省了区块空间,还增加了复杂合约的隐私性。这对闪电网络和原子互换协议等高级功能实现至关重要。

比特币密钥的安全实践

存储规范

私钥存储是保障安全的关键步骤,建议采用硬件钱包进行冷存储,并结合BIP-39助记词来离线保存。此外,热钱包的使用场景需加强安全,建议启用隔离见证地址及多重签名,显著降低私钥被暴露的风险。

风险防范

在管理私钥时,需遵循最小暴露原则,避免在联网环境中直接处理私钥。在签名不同交易时,必须避免重复使用相同随机数(nonce),定期验证地址余额与公钥哈希的匹配度以提高安全性。

新兴技术

随着技术的发展,密码学领域出现了门限签名方案(TSS),将私钥分割为多个分片,形成多节点协同签名的模式,大大增强了安全性。此外,零知识证明技术(如zk-SNARKs)在不暴露私钥的条件下验证所有权,将成为未来隐私钱包和复杂合约的重要支撑。

综上所述,比特币密钥体系是区块链“去中心化信任”的密码学基础。熟悉密钥的定义、作用及其灵活应用,是每个比特币用户确保资产安全的根本。理解并运用这些安全实践,将为您在比特币资产管理中提供不可或缺的支持,使您在数字金融蓝海中站稳脚跟。

币安
币安
简介: 币安(Binance)是一家全球领先的加密货币交易平台,提供安全、多样化的交易服务,并支持众多数字资产。